This is a RASHAQ style hilt, and yes, it is likely a more recently produced item. The way to tell is that the silver (or brass) hilt decoration is usually much thinner on the later items whereas the earlier ones have nice thick silver. The blade style is (I think) called MUAYYAR which describes those with a central rib, thought this one also has fullers each side of the rib, which is not usual in the older versions.
